Implementation of a Web-based teleradiology management system

Summary
A new web-based teleradiology management system (TMS) automates image transfers between hospitals. This system significantly reduced staff time spent on image transfers, improving efficiency in Picture Archiving and Communication Systems (PACS) workflows.

Background:
- Hospitals utilize Picture Archiving and Communication Systems (PACS) for medical image management.
- Transferring patient images between facilities using PACS presents logistical challenges.
Purpose of the Study:
- To develop and evaluate a web-based Teleradiology Management System (TMS) to automate image and report transfers.
- To assess the impact of the TMS on operational efficiency and staff workload.
Main Methods:
- Implementation of a web-based TMS across five Queensland hospitals.
- Monitoring of 752 image and report transmissions over a two-month study period.
- Collection of feedback from PACS support personnel regarding time savings.
Main Results:
- All 752 transmitted studies and associated radiologists' reports reached their destinations correctly.
- Automated notifications were successfully sent to system administrators.
- PACS support staff reported a significant reduction in time spent on image transfers.
Conclusions:
- The TMS effectively automates teleradiology processes, including image and report transfer.
- The system demonstrably reduces workload for PACS support personnel.
- Web-based solutions can enhance efficiency in inter-facility medical image management.
